The Proofing Tools are automatically included during a normal installation,
so unless you customized the install & specifically chose to *not* include
them they are most likely there somewhere:) Have you perhaps moved anything
(folders) around or deleted anything since the install? Unfortunately the
message we get don't always accurately describe the problem.
First, take a look at where the files should be:
Microsoft Office 2004/Shared Applications/Proofing Tools folder
More probable is that the tools are there, but that there is something about
some or all of the doc's language setting that is confusing the program &
preventing it from using those tools. Assuming that it *is* intended to be
all US English:
Select all the text, then go to Tools>Language select English (US), and make
sure to clear the checkbox labeled "Do not check spelling or grammar". If
